What does it mean to be a Registered Agent?
A registered agent is a designated individual or company that acts as a main point of contact for a corporation or limited liability company. This agent is responsible for receiving legal documents , government notices , and other important correspondence on behalf of the company. Having a registered agent is a mandated necessity in many jurisdictions , including Washington, and ensures that businesses remain aligned with state regulations.
The role of a registered agent is crucial for maintaining the requirements of a corporation. They help ensure that necessary communications are received in a prompt manner, which can protect the business's legal standing. This person or service must be available during typical business hours and must have a real address in the state where the business is established or functions.

Importance of a Registered Agent in Washington
A registered agent in the State of Washington plays a essential role in ensuring that a enterprise remains aligned with state regulations. They serve as the designated point of contact for get critical legal notices, such as lawsuits and government notices. This is crucial because failing to react to these notices can result in legal issues or penalties for the company. By having a specific registered agent, businesses can make sure that they obtain timely notifications and can take suitable action, thereby protecting their assets.
Furthermore, a registered agent offers discretion for entrepreneurs. By using a registered agent's contact information for service of process, founders can keep their private details confidential. This is particularly beneficial for small business owners who conduct business from their residences. It enables them to avoid unsolicited salespeople or inquiries at their home residences, promoting a more respectable image for their enterprise while protecting their personal space.
Additionally, having a reliable registered agent aids companies manage their ongoing regulatory obligations. In the State of Washington, enterprises are required to file annual updates and maintain accurate records. A registered agent can help with these requirements, confirming that necessary submissions are finished on time. This help not only alleviates the management tasks from business owners but also ensures that they remain in good status with the state, reducing the risk of fines or complications.

Cost and Fees of WA Registered Agents
The cost of engaging a registered agent in Washington can differ greatly depending on the vendor and the capabilities included in their plans. On average, you can look to pay to expend between $100 and $300 per year for typical registered agent services. This charge generally covers the acceptance of official documents, delivery of process, and regulatory notifications. Some vendors may extend additional services such as post forwarding or annual report filing, which may impact the total pricing.

Altering Your Designated Agent in the State of Washington
Modifying your designated agent in Washington is a straightforward process that requires particular steps to ensure compliance with state regulations. To begin, you need to decide whether you are appointing a different registered agent or just updating the details for your current agent. If you decide to appoint a different registered agent, ensure that they fulfill the state's requirements, such as being a local individual or a business entity licensed to conduct business in the state.
Once you have picked your new registered agent, you have to fill out a Registered Agent Change form, which can be accessed from the Washington Secretary of State's website. This form will require details about your business, including the title and location of the current registered agent, as well as the incoming agent's details. Ensure to review the information thoroughly before submission to prevent any delays in handling.
After filling out the form, you will send it along with any applicable fees to the Secretary of State's office. Once the modification is processed, the new agent will be officially recognized, and you should inform your former agent of the modification. Additionally, it is a good practice to update your business records and notify any concerned parties of the different registered agent's contact information to maintain clear communication and compliance.
